Key job responsibilities - Lead the design and implementation of software systems that span multiple features, driving technical decisions from customer requirements through deployment and ongoing maintenance. - Own your team's architectural direction by evaluating trade-offs across scalability, maintainability, performance, and security, and influence technical decisions on systems your team depends on. - Collaborate with engineers across related teams to ensure software components integrate into a coherent whole, establishing the right checkpoints for successful cross-team delivery. - Mentor and coach engineers on your team and beyond, driving adoption of engineering best practices, conducting design and code reviews, and raising the quality bar across the organization. - Improve operational excellence by ensuring your team maintains proper alarms, telemetry, runbooks, and retrospective processes, and proactively identify opportunities to simplify existing systems. A day in the life You start by reviewing a technical design document from a teammate, providing feedback that strengthens the approach before implementation begins. Later, you lead a working session with engineers from a partner team to align on an interface contract for a shared dependency. After lunch, you write code for a critical component you identified during an architecture review, applying best practices in error handling and documentation. You wrap up by pairing with a junior engineer on a tricky debugging session, turning it into a coaching moment.
